The Big Idea: Decentralized Predictive Maintenance for Sustainable Agrifood Operations
We propose launching a lean, software-as-a-service (SaaS) platform focused on providing predictive maintenance insights specifically for the sustainable agrifood sector – encompassing vertical farms, cultivated meat facilities, and advanced plant-based processing plants. Our core offering, “Verifiable Asset Intelligence,” is designed to optimize operational uptime, enhance resource efficiency, and ensure stringent compliance through a unique blend of data analytics and blockchain technology.
At its heart, the platform will collect and analyze sensor data from critical equipment (e.g., HVAC systems, bioreactors, pumps, irrigation systems, processing machinery) to predict potential failures before they occur. However, our distinct advantage lies in integrating Web3 technologies: each piece of monitored equipment will have an associated Non-Fungible Token (NFT) acting as a secure, immutable digital twin. This NFT will store a verifiable, tamper-proof log of maintenance history, calibration records, and even supply chain provenance of critical components. This provides unparalleled transparency and auditability, essential for an industry under intense scrutiny for safety, quality, and environmental impact.
Our solution isn’t about replacing existing hardware; rather, it’s a powerful software layer designed to integrate with existing low-cost IoT sensors, SCADA systems, or even manual data inputs, transforming raw data into actionable intelligence. The focus is on early warning systems, resource optimization alerts (e.g., identifying energy consumption anomalies, water leakage predictions), and a streamlined, auditable maintenance workflow.

Explosive Market Growth & Critical Need: The sustainable agrifood sector is experiencing exponential growth, driven by environmental concerns, food security challenges, and consumer demand for alternative proteins. These facilities are capital-intensive, highly automated, and rely on continuous operation. Downtime of a bioreactor, a climate control system in a vertical farm, or a processing line can lead to catastrophic losses in yield, product quality degradation, and significant energy and water waste. Predictive maintenance directly addresses this critical pain point, ensuring operational continuity and protecting investments.

Action Plan: From Concept to Pilot
Our 10,000 Euro initial investment necessitates an extremely lean, equity-focused approach for the team, with the budget primarily covering essential operational costs and initial development tools.
Phase 1: Concept Validation & Foundation (Weeks 1-4) – Budget: €3,000
- Market Deep Dive & Niche Refinement (€1,000): Led by the Alternative Proteins expert, conduct in-depth interviews with 20-30 potential customers (vertical farms, cultivated meat startups) to validate specific pain points, identify critical assets for monitoring, and prioritize initial features.
- Legal & Administrative Setup (€1,000): Led by Legal Automation expert. Register the company, establish basic operational agreements, draft initial service terms for pilot customers, and ensure compliance groundwork for data handling.
- Architectural Blueprint & Tech Stack Selection (€500): Led by Predictive Maintenance and Web3 experts. Define the MVP’s technical architecture, select open-source libraries, cloud services (e.g., AWS Free Tier, Google Cloud credits), and blockchain platforms for NFT implementation.
- Team Alignment & Core Feature Prioritization (€500): All team members contribute to defining the absolute minimum viable feature set (e.g., monitoring temperature anomaly in one bioreactor type, basic alert system, immutable log for one maintenance event).
Phase 2: MVP Development & Initial Training (Weeks 5-12) – Budget: €4,000
- Backend & Data Ingestion Development (€1,500): Predictive Maintenance expert and Web3 expert collaborate to build the data ingestion pipeline (API for existing sensors, manual input interface) and the backend logic for initial anomaly detection (simple thresholding, trend analysis).
- NFT & Blockchain Integration (€1,000): Web3 expert develops the smart contracts for NFT creation (representing assets) and for securely logging maintenance events on a chosen blockchain (e.g., Polygon for low gas fees).
- User Interface & Dashboard Development (€1,000): EdTech expert leads the development of an intuitive, user-friendly frontend dashboard for viewing asset status, alerts, and accessing verifiable maintenance records. Focus on clarity and actionable insights.
- Pilot Customer Onboarding Materials (€500): EdTech expert develops initial training videos, user manuals, and onboarding guides for pilot clients.
Phase 3: Pilot Deployment & Iteration (Weeks 13-20) – Budget: €3,000
- Pilot Customer Acquisition & Onboarding (€1,000): Alternative Proteins and Sustainable Tourism experts lead outreach to secure 3-5 pilot customers identified in Phase 1. EdTech expert provides personalized onboarding support.
- System Deployment & Monitoring (€1,000): Predictive Maintenance and Web3 experts deploy the MVP, integrate with pilot customers’ existing sensor infrastructure (or guide them on minimal sensor procurement), and continuously monitor system performance.
- Feedback Collection & Iteration Loop (€500): All team members actively collect feedback from pilot users, identify areas for improvement, and prioritize next feature developments.
- Marketing & Storytelling Preparation (€500): Sustainable Tourism and EdTech experts begin drafting case studies based on early pilot successes, preparing initial marketing collateral for investor pitches and broader outreach.
